Output 2581d19a9ecd7665c7a074f4e09b1c2804d0915735a058a5abafc84d1b415fda:1

value
1410653
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508bdaf791a0509d071ed3d09fa8a18aea0b5fba OP_EQUALVERIFY OP_CHECKSIG
address
18LtbfcpSV31HXH5fnw4JepZzrkiWbE9vA
transaction
2581d19a9ecd7665c7a074f4e09b1c2804d0915735a058a5abafc84d1b415fda
spent
true